Michael Palmer asked about work on the use of fungi for the control of
varroa.

I think that others may be able to provide a better update on the current
situation, but the links below provide basic information.  Our Association
was fortunate to be able to visit HRI, which is just down the road from
Stratford-upon-Avon, in early 2001 and meet Dr David Chandler and his team
who gave us a fascinating talk about their work.
